Brazil's January steel production rises, except for semis
Brazil saw crude-steel and rolled-products volumes increase month-on-month and year-on-year in January, Kallanish notes.
According to data issued by the national steelmakers association Instituto Aço Brasil (IAB), January crude steel output totalled 2.72 million tonnes, up 8.1% on the previous month and 0.4% more on-year.
Almost 76.2% of Brazilian output during the month was produced by the basic oxygen furnace process, providing 2.07mt of steel.
